The UN is looking for authoritative scientific data and analysis to be made freely obtainable, to speed up analysis into an efficient vaccine towards the COVID-19 virus, assist counter misinformation, and “unlock the complete potential of science”.
Arguing that no-one is secure till everyone seems to be secure, the World Well being Group (WHO) has, for a number of months, been urging nations and scientists to collaborate, in a bid to deliver the pandemic underneath management. This has concerned the creation, alongside governments, scientists, foundations, the personal sector and different companions, of a groundbreaking platform to speed up the event of assessments, remedies and vaccines.
In October, the top of the company, Tedros Ghebreyesus Adhanom, alongside human rights chief Michelle Bachelet, and Audrey Azoulay, Director-Normal of science, tradition and training company UNESCO, issued a call for “Open Science”, describing it as a “elementary matter of human rights”, and arguing for cutting-edge applied sciences and discoveries to be obtainable for individuals who want them most.
However what precisely does Open Science imply, and why does the UN insist on making it extra widespread?
1) What’s ‘Open Science’?
Open Science has been described as a rising motion aimed toward making the scientific course of extra clear and inclusive by making scientific information, strategies, information and proof freely obtainable and accessible for everybody.
The Open Science motion has emerged from the scientific neighborhood and has quickly unfold throughout nations. Traders, entrepreneurs, coverage makers and residents are becoming a member of this name.
Nonetheless, the company additionally warns that, within the fragmented scientific and coverage surroundings, a worldwide understanding of the that means, alternatives and challenges of Open Science continues to be lacking.
2) Why is Open Science necessary?
Open Science facilitates scientific collaboration and the sharing of data for the good thing about science and society, creating extra and higher scientific information, and spreading it to the broader inhabitants.
UNESCO has described Open Science as a “true sport changer”: by making data extensively obtainable, extra individuals can profit from scientific and technological innovation.
3) Why is it wanted now?
As a result of, in a world that’s extra inter-connected than ever earlier than, a lot of as we speak’s challenges don’t respect political or geographic borders, and powerful worldwide scientific collaboration is crucial to beat the issues. The COVID-19 pandemic is a major instance.
We even have the instruments to make it occur: with digitalization changing into ever extra widespread, it’s far simpler than ever earlier than to share scientific information and information, that are wanted to allow choices that may result in overcoming international challenges to be primarily based on dependable proof.
4) What’s the influence of Open Science on the pandemic?
On this international well being emergency, because of worldwide collaboration, scientists have improved their understanding of the coronavirus with unprecedented pace and openness, embracing the rules of Open Science. Journals, universities, personal labs, and information repositories have joined the motion, permitting open entry to information and data: some 115,000 publications have launched data associated to the virus and the pandemic, and greater than 80 per cent of them may be considered, at no cost, by most people.
Early within the pandemic, for instance, Chinese language scientists readily shared the genome of the virus, jumpstarting all following analysis into the virus, and the diagnostic testing, remedies, and vaccines which have since been developed.
Lastly, the disaster has underlined the pressing must deliver science nearer to resolution making and to society as a complete. Preventing misinformation and selling evidence-based decision-making, supported by well-informed residents, has confirmed to be of significant significance within the battle towards COVID 19.
5) What’s the UN doing to advertise Open Science?
To make sure that Open Science actually meets its potential, and advantages each developed and creating nations, UNESCO is taking the lead in constructing a worldwide consensus on values and rules for Open Science which might be related for each scientists and each particular person independently of their place of birth, gender, age or financial and social background.
The longer term UNESCO Recommendation on Open Science is anticipated to be the worldwide instrument to set the proper and simply requirements for Open Science globally, which fulfil the human proper to science and go away nobody behind.
In an announcement launched on World Science Day for Peace and Development, celebrated on 10 November, Ms. Azoulay stated that widening the scope of Open Science will assist science to “unlock its full potential”, making it more practical and numerous by “enabling anybody to contribute, but in addition to deliver its targets consistent with the wants of society, by creating scientific literacy in an knowledgeable citizenry who take duty and are concerned in collective decision-making”.
